Complete Buyer's Guide: How to Choose a Water Bottle for Youth Sports

1. Material Matters: Plastic vs. Stainless Steel

When it comes to youth sports, the material of your water bottle can make a big difference. Stainless steel bottles like the Gatorade Kids’ Rookie offer superior insulation and durability, keeping drinks cold for hours and surviving drops. However, they can be heavier and more expensive.

Plastic bottles, such as the Opard 30oz, are lighter and often more affordable, but may not insulate as well and can be prone to cracking over time. Look for BPA-free Tritan plastic for the best balance of safety and durability.

2. Size and Capacity: Matching the Activity

Choosing the right size depends on your child’s age and the sport’s intensity. Smaller bottles (12-20oz) are great for younger kids or short practices, as they’re easy to carry and drink from. The Gatorade 12oz is perfect for little hands.

For older athletes or all-day tournaments, consider larger capacities (30-64oz) like the Under Armour 64oz. Just remember that bigger bottles can be bulky, so weigh the need for hydration against portability.

3. Lid Types: Straws, Squeeze, and Flip-Tops

The lid design affects how easily your child can hydrate during activity. Straw lids are spill-proof and great for quick sips, but require cleaning. Squeeze bottles allow one-handed drinking but may leak if not used properly.

Flip-top lids offer a balance of convenience and leak resistance, though mechanisms can vary in durability. Test different styles to see what your child prefers—ease of use can encourage more frequent drinking.

4. Insulation: Keeping Drinks Cold

Insulation is crucial for maintaining water temperature during outdoor sports. Double-wall vacuum insulation in stainless steel bottles can keep drinks cold for 24 hours, while foam insulation in plastic models may last 10-12 hours.

If your child plays in hot climates, prioritize bottles with proven insulation. Pre-chilling the bottle before adding ice can enhance performance, as seen with the Under Armour insulated options.

5. Durability and Leak Proofing

Youth sports are rough on gear, so look for bottles that can handle drops and impacts. Stainless steel with protective coatings tends to be more dent-resistant, while high-quality plastics should have reinforced seams.

Leak proofing is non-negotiable—check for secure seals and lockable lids. Real user feedback is key here, as some bottles claim leak-proof status but don’t deliver in practice.

6. Ease of Cleaning and Maintenance

Bottles that are dishwasher safe save time and ensure thorough cleaning, but some lids may require hand washing. Wide mouths make it easier to scrub inside, while straws need brushes for proper maintenance.

Consider your cleaning routine—if simplicity is important, opt for bottles with fewer parts or top-rack dishwasher safety like the Under Armour Sideline Squeeze.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What size water bottle is best for youth sports?

It depends on the age and activity level. For younger children (5-8 years), 12-20oz bottles are ideal as they’re lightweight and easy to handle. For older kids (9+ years) or longer practices, 24-32oz bottles provide enough hydration without being too bulky. Tournament players might prefer 64oz jugs for all-day use.

2. Are stainless steel water bottles better than plastic for sports?

Stainless steel bottles generally offer better insulation and durability, making them great for maintaining cold temperatures and surviving drops. However, they can be heavier and more expensive. Plastic bottles are lighter and often more affordable, but may not keep drinks cold as long and can be less durable. For youth sports, stainless steel is often worth the investment if budget allows.

3. How do I prevent water bottles from leaking in sports bags?

Look for bottles with secure, lockable lids and positive user reviews about leak resistance. Squeeze bottles with one-way valves and flip-tops with reliable seals tend to perform well. Always test the bottle at home by shaking it upside down before relying on it for sports. Storage orientation matters too—keeping bottles upright in bags can help prevent leaks.

4. Can I put sports water bottles in the dishwasher?

Many bottles are dishwasher safe on the top rack, but always check the manufacturer’s instructions. Stainless steel bodies usually handle dishwashers well, while plastic lids and straws may require hand washing to preserve their integrity. For example, the Drinco stainless steel bottle is fully dishwasher safe, but some plastic models recommend hand washing only.

5. What features are most important for youth sports water bottles?

Focus on durability, leak proofing, ease of use, and insulation. Kids need bottles that can withstand rough handling, won’t leak in gear bags, are simple to open and drink from quickly, and keep water cool during extended activities. Additional features like carrying handles, fence hooks, or motivational markers can enhance convenience but shouldn’t compromise core functionality.
